Part 16 - Deployment and DevOps

Part 15 - Deployment and DevOps

42. Docker & Containerization

Building Docker containers for .NET 10 APIs: multi-stage builds, docker-compose, and registry management

43. Configuration Management

Managing application configuration safely: appsettings hierarchy, user secrets, environment variables, and Azure Key Vault

44. CI/CD Pipeline

Continuous integration and deployment with GitHub Actions: automated builds, tests, and deployments